To use #Snapshot:

Step 2: After installing it, create a new virtual machine and install a Windows, Linux, or macOS operating system on the virtual machine that you created.
Step 3: You can use Snapshot to back up a virtual machine. The Snapshot feature in VMware saves you time. You can compare Snapshot to the "System Restore" feature used in Windows operating systems.
Step 4: Shut down the virtual machine before taking a Snapshot. (You can also get Snapshot when the virtual machine is running.)
Step 5: After you shut down the VM, click on the Take Snapshot button from the menu.
Step 6: In the Take Snapshot window, type a name and description to back up the snapshot status of the virtual machine. Type in detailed information about the description of Snapshot.
Step 7: Click on the Take Snapshot button to start the process.
Step 8: After clicking it, the window will close.
Step 9: Now click on Snapshot Manager to check the Snapshot you created.
Step 10: You can see a backup of the virtual machine on the Snapshot Manager.
Step 11: Changes to the virtual machine will not affect Snapshot!
Step 12: Install a program as an example to test it.
Step 13: Power off the VM and now open Snapshot Manager again.
Step 14: Select the backup you created to restore the VM and click Go To.
Step 15: Start the virtual machine.
Step 16: After running the VM, you will see that you have no programs installed!
